[Merge] lp:~maddock-evan/onboard/ayatana-appindicator into lp:onboard

Evan Maddock mp+450912 at code.launchpad.net
Thu Sep 7 16:26:53 UTC 2023


You have been requested to review the proposed merge of lp:~maddock-evan/onboard/ayatana-appindicator into lp:onboard.

For more details, see:
https://code.launchpad.net/~maddock-evan/onboard/ayatana-appindicator/+merge/450912

This enables using AyatanaAppIndicator for the AppIndicator backend instead of AppIndicator3. AyatanaAppIndicator is the successor to AppIndicator, and limiting the indicator to the old library means that the Onboard indicator may not be shown on certain Linux distributions and desktop environments.

To ensure backwards compatibility, the indicator will attempt to fall back to the old AppIndicator import if it fails to import AyatanaAppIndicator.

This was tested on Solus 4.4 using the Budgie Desktop environment (Budgie version 10.8), a combination which uses AyatanaAppIndicator and not AppIndicator.

-- 
Your team Ubuntu Sponsors is requested to review the proposed merge of lp:~maddock-evan/onboard/ayatana-appindicator into lp:onboard.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: review-diff.txt
Type: text/x-diff
Size: 1028 bytes
Desc: not available
URL: <https://lists.ubuntu.com/archives/ubuntu-sponsors/attachments/20230907/d7109bfb/attachment-0001.diff>


More information about the Ubuntu-sponsors mailing list